Ger Lyons has his horses in such good form that Casimiro is respected on just his second start for the yard after an eye-catching effort here last time. Alans Pride appears to enjoy running in huge fields as he gained his second victory against 29 opponents when returning at the Curragh. He's shot up 10lb and this is tougher, especially as Gunmaker was having his first start for Gavin Cromwell when gaining a surprise victory at Dundalk and will make a bold bid to follow up despite a 9lb rise. PROSECUTION has never won and has gone up in the weights again after again finding a mile on heavy ground just too far at the Curragh but it's about time he was losing his maiden tag and he's handed the vote. Both Markhan and King Torus are very well treated at their best and any money for either should be noted.
